1. Neely’s Barbecue Parlor– This restaurant is owned by Food Network stars Chef Pat and Gina Neely, located at 1125 1st avenue, New York, NY. If you’re looking for some southern style home-cooked, hearty soul food, this is the place for you to try.

2. Shuko– Sushi has become very popular these days, but not everyone has good sushi. Shuko is one of the top-rated sushi places in NYC.  What makes this sushi place a little diffrent is that it offers daily testing menus, and it’s 20 seats, so it’s a little more intimate and not very loud. The menu is based on traditional Japanese flavors.  It opens up at 5 pm Mon thru Saturday, so definitely stop in after a long day of work. Location is 47 East 12th st New York, NY.

Ricardo Steak House–  This awesome steakhouse is located in East Harlem, where art covers the walls and there is a quiet little patio outback.  The vibe is cool, laid back, and they play great music. It does get crowded in the evenings and on weekends, so if you can call ahead, make reservations. Location is 2145 2nd Ave New York, NY.

4. Tropical Grill– This place boasts a perfect blend of Puerto Rican and Dominican dishes. It opens at 7 am, and serves EVERYTHING from breakfast to dinner. If you are looking for authentic Latin American food, head over to 2145 Adam Clay Powell Jr Blvd.

5. Settepani– This spot is a blend of Italian/Meditterranean cuisine that is known for their amazing pastries and wine selection. The restaurant is stylish, and offers both indoor and outdoor seating. They offer all sorts of muffins, scones, cannolis, baguettes just to name a few. You can order wholesale, and they offer catering as well. Every Thursday from 7 pm to 10 pm, they also have live jazz, which sounds pretty cool. Located at 196 Malcolm X Blvd New York, NY.
